We have a query and whant to secure maximum speed. How shall I interpret =

the

Sys(3054,11) report?

Is there more to do?

Sys(3054,11) reports:

Rushmore optimzation level for tblcomp1: none

Rushmore optimzation level for tblaccomps: none

Rushmore optimzation level for tblcont1: none

Rushmore optimzation level for tblacconts: none

Joining tblcomp1 and tblaccomps using index tag Acctocomp

Joining intermediate result and tblcont1 using temp index

Joining intermediate result and tblacconts using temp index

The query:

Select tblComp1.Company, tblCont1.aftername, tblCont1.forename,

TblCont1.ct1_ct234, ;

TblComp1.c1to234, tblComp1.Det014,tblComp1.Det015,tblCont1.Det014 as

ContDet014 ;

FROM tblComp1 ;

LEFT JOIN tblAccomps ON tblComp1.C1To234 =3D tblAccomps.AccToComp ;

LEFT JOIN tblCont1 ON tblComp1.C1To234 =3D tblCont1.Ct1_c1_234 ;

LEFT JOIN tblAcconts ON tblCont1.Ct1_ct234 =3D TblAcconts.AccToCont1

The tables have following indexes:

tblComp1.C1To234 Primary

tblAccomps.AccToComp Regular

tblCont1.Ct1_c1_234 Regular

tblCont1.Ct1_ct234 Candidate

TblAcconts.AccToCont1 Regular

Why doesn=B4t Rushmore use my indexes? What am I doing wrong? Any help wo=
